Common Issues with Fire Shutters:

There are several common issues that may arise with fire shutters. These include:

1. Misalignment: Over time, fire shutters may become misaligned, preventing them from closing properly. This can compromise their ability to contain a fire.

2. Damage: Fire shutters can be damaged due to various reasons, such as accidental impact or wear and tear. This damage needs to be repaired promptly to ensure the shutter’s effectiveness.

3. Rust: Rust is a common issue with metal fire shutters. Rust can weaken the structure of the shutter, making it less effective in containing fires.

4. Motor Failure: Many fire shutters are equipped with motors for automatic opening and closing. If the motor fails, the shutter may not function correctly during a fire emergency.

Steps in Fire Shutter Repair:

When a fire shutter is in need of repair, it is essential to contact a professional fire shutter repair technician to handle the job. Here are the steps involved in fire shutter repair:

1. Inspection: The technician will inspect the fire shutter to identify any issues that need to be addressed. This may involve checking for misalignment, damage, rust, motor failure, or any other issues.

2. Repair Plan: Based on the inspection, the technician will develop a repair plan outlining the steps needed to fix the issues with the fire shutter.

3. Replacement of Parts: If any parts of the fire shutter are damaged and cannot be repaired, the technician will replace them with new parts to ensure the shutter’s functionality.

4. Testing: Once the repairs are complete, the technician will test the fire shutter to ensure it is working correctly. This may involve opening and closing the shutter multiple times to ensure it functions smoothly.

5. Maintenance: After the repair is complete, the technician may recommend regular maintenance to prevent future issues with the fire shutter. This may involve lubricating moving parts, checking for rust, and other routine maintenance tasks.
